The TRMM satellite ceased its observation mission in April 2015. It was replaced by the Global Precipitation Measurement (GPM) satellite, a joint program sponsored by NASA and the Japan Aerospace Exploration Agency. The GPM program includes satellites from multiple countries to provide global precipitation and snowfall …

The Global Precipitation Measurement (GPM) mission is an international collaboration that uses multiple satellites orbiting Earth to collect rain, snow and other precipitation data worldwide every thirty minutes. NASA’s Global Precipitation Measurement Mission (GPM) uses satellites to measure Earth's rain and snowfall for the benefit of mankind. Launched by NASA and JAXA on Feb. 27th, 2014, GPM is an international mission that sets the standard for spaceborne precipitation measurements. This animation shows the average amount of precipitation that falls on each day of the year (mm/day), computed from 2001 - 2018. Download NetCDF files of the IMERG V06 Final Run Daily Climatology. The daily climatology dataset covers January 2001 to December 2018, computed as a trailing 30-day average to reduce the random noise due to isolated ... The Global Precipitation Measurement Core Observatory (GPM) surveys Earth’s weather from 65 degrees north to 65 degrees south latitude. The initiative supported new users from established and underrepresented user communities, providing a tailored hands-on …GPM & TRMM Data Usage Policy. GPM and TRMM data are freely available at all levels for which the particular sensor or sensor combination has been processed by GPM. For the GPM Core Observatory this is for Levels 0 through 3 products (as applicable).
